Jesso","description":"In this Adventures Through The Mind micro, I explain what MDMA is and why it makes us feel love. I explain why MDMA is an entactogen rather than a classic psychedelic, and how it floods the brain with serotonin. I also discuss how it raises our sense of safety, lowers our sense of danger, and drops the emotional boundaries we normally hold, which is what made it work in couples therapy. Finally, I cover the PTSD research, and why MDMA with someone new can leave you holding an intimacy you have not earned.
